Can we add vegetables to the Amish country casserole?

I have made this dish so many times with different vegetables in it. You can always increase the flavors and the nutritional value of the dish with vegetables. Most of the mothers make casseroles with vegetables as this is the only way their kids will eat them. And, it is easy because kids love a cheesy and creamy casserole . You can add carrots, broccoli, green onion, potatoes, asparagus, peas, and mushrooms. 

This is a traditional recipe but if you want you can add cheese on top as well. We love cheese in our casseroles, don’t we? It is your choice to customize your dish to your liking. 

Can we store it?

Of course, you can. It will be perfectly fine for 3-4 days in the fridge. If you want you can prepare the pasta, beef and add everything to a container. Whenever you want to eat it, take some out and garnish with cheese, parsley, and paprika. Bake it for 30-35 minutes and your delicious meal is ready. It is a perfect recipe for those who prepare meals ahead of time. You can serve corn, baked potatoes, dips, hand-tossed salad, beans, and anything you like as a side with it. Amish Country Casserole

Course: Main Course
Cuisine: American
Keyword: Amish Country Casserole
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 35 minutes
Total Time: 45 minutes
Servings: 10

Ingredients

  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 packet of pasta You can use any pasta you like
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• Onion 1 chopped
  • Garlic chopped or crushed 2 tablespoons You can use store-bought garlic paste as well
  • Ground beef 750 grams
  • Tomato soup 1 can
  • Mushroom soup 1 can
  • Milk 1 cup
  • Half tablespoon paprika
  • Half tablespoon parsley

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 200 degrees F. Grease a baking pan while you prepare your ingredients.
  • Cook your pasta based on the instructions on the back of the packet.
  • While the pasta is cooking take a skillet and sauté the garlic and onion . Add the beef in it and let it cook for a while.
  • Drain your pasta and add some cold water on it so it does not stick.
  • In a large bowl add pasta, beef cooked in the skillet, mushroom and tomato soup, milk, salt, and pepper.
  • Add the mixture to the baking dish and garnish with paprika and parsley. Bake it for 20-25 minutes.
